摘 要:随着电力行业智能化进程的快速发展,人们对智能变电站远动通信自动对点调试的成本、效率、智能化研究等方面提出了更高的要求和目标。基于此,对远动通信的自动对点调试系统进行科学研究。首先,分析对点调试系统构架及其重要性;其次,对不同模块功能、原理和调试关联性进行介绍;最后,探讨了智能变电站自动对点调试系统的应用效果。通过不同模块设计和信息联动,以四遥远动对点等方式为对象,构建智能变电站自动对点调试系统,在不同站、控制中心内进行调度调试任务,并校核了调试精度。结果表明,智能化对点调试节约了大量的人工成本和时间成本,实现了数据备份、离线操作以及对点调试扩展。With the rapid development of the intelligent process in the power industry,people have put forward higher requirements and goals for the cost,efficiency,and intelligent research of automatic point-to-point debugging of telecontrol communication in intelligent substations.In summary,scientific research is carried out on the automatic point-to-point debugging system of telecontrol communication.Firstly,the structure and importance of the point-topoint debugging system are analyzed.Secondly,the functions,principles and debugging correlations of different modules are introduced.Finally,the application effect of the automatic point-to-point debugging system for smart substations is discussed.Through the design of different modules and information linkage,the automatic point-to-point debugging system for intelligent substations is constructed with four remote mobile-to-point methods as objects,and the scheduling and debugging tasks are carried out in different stations and control centers,and the debugging accuracy is checked.The results show that intelligent point-to-point debugging saves a lot of labor cost and time cost,and realizes data backup,offline operation and point-to-point debugging expansion.
